Unit Definitions

What is Megabyte ?

A Megabyte (MB)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000 bytes (or 8,000,000 bits) and commonly used to express the size of a file or the amount of memory used by a program. It is also used to express data transfer speeds and in the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of mebibyte (MiB) is used instead.

What is Zebibyte ?

A Zebibyte (ZiB)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,180,591,620,717,411,303,424 bytes (or 9,444,732,965,739,290,427,392 bits) and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'zebi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'zettabyte' (ZB).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the storage size of high end servers and data storage arrays.
